What Happened?
Eli Lilly (LLY) stock dipped after the company announced its latest deal in an ongoing acquisition spree. Lilly agreed to buy privately-held Merida Biosciences for $2.9 billion in cash.
Merida’s lead candidate, MER511, is part of a pipeline of experimental biologic drugs targeting autoimmune and allergic diseases, including Graves’ disease and thyroid eye disease.
The deal adds early-stage precision immunology assets to a portfolio that already covers metabolic and neurology treatments.
It’s the latest in a string of business development moves this year for Eli Lilly, which has also picked up companies like Curevo, LimmaTech Biologics, the Vaccine Company, and AtaiBeckley in recent months to expand into infectious disease prevention and mental health.

Alongside the Merida news, Lilly also shared new Phase 3b TOGETHER trial results.
The data showed durable 52-week efficacy when combining Taltz and Zepbound in patients dealing with both psoriatic disease and obesity.
This dual therapy approach targets psoriatic disease activity and metabolic outcomes at the same time, a strategy Lilly is calling immunometabolism.

What the Market Is Telling Us About Eli Lilly Stock
The small drop in Eli Lilly stock suggests investors are still processing what this deal means for the company’s broader strategy.
Right now, Lilly’s growth story leans heavily on its GLP-1 franchise. In Q2, Zepbound and Mounjaro combined for $14.9 billion in revenue, up $6.3 billion year-over-year, and total company revenue grew 48% compared to the same period last year.
That heavy reliance on GLP-1 drugs is exactly why deals like Merida matter.
Analysts have pointed out the risk of leaning too much on one class of blockbuster drugs, especially with policy-driven pricing pressure a real concern across the industry.
Building out an autoimmune and immunology pipeline gives Lilly a second growth leg that doesn’t depend on incretin sales.
The TOGETHER trial data adds another layer. Rather than treating GLP-1 drugs as a standalone obesity story, Lilly is testing whether pairing them with existing immunology drugs like Taltz can address multiple conditions at once.
That fits the company’s stated strategy of pursuing “next-gen oral and injectable GLP-1, new indications, and precision therapies” alongside disciplined capital allocation.

Eli Lilly’s R&D engine has been busy across the board this year, with more than 40 active Phase 3 programs and increasing investment in pipeline expansion.
Whether Eli Lilly stock benefits long-term from this diversification push will depend on how these early-stage immunology assets progress through clinical trials, and how much investors continue to value Lilly as a GLP-1 leader versus a broader immunology and neuroscience company.
